Find Jobs
Hire Freelancers

ASP.NET Core Web API basic project

$30-250 USD

Completed
Posted about 6 years ago

$30-250 USD

Paid on delivery
The scope of the project is a simple .Net core 2 / MVC 6 web api and a simple test client. Clients should be created using Visual Studio 2017, Windows Platform, ASP.NET Core 2 MVC, c#, SQL Server (Not SQL Express). We will provide simple SQL server table. Server Web API will be able to 1. Reply to a get request with an simple SQL query retrieving information from a table. 2. Reply to a post request with an update to a database and return status code. 3. Authentication: Authenticate the client against the server with a username/password, a JWT token should be created for the session. We are open to what authentication system you suggest (Local, google based or anything else you have in mind), just specify in your bid what you have mind. Client Side 1. Authenticate the client against the server with a username/password, a JWT token should be created for the session. We are open to what authentication system you suggest (Local, google based or anything else you have in mind), just specify in your bid what you have mind. 2. Require to re-enter username/password if client is active for N minutes. Re-authenticate and create a new token if correct username/password entered. If not, keep asking for username/password and allow user to exit application/ 3. Send a get request (Server task #1) and present the results in a grid. Database will have a field called Marked. Any record that has Marked set as 1, will be highlighted in green. 4. Send a post request (Server task #2) by right clicking on the row in the grid and clicking mark row. Marked row will be highlighted in green and the record represented in the marked record in the database will get updated. 5. Apply simple filter to show all records, only marked records (Marked=1) or all records. 6. Form should include on the side a Chromium web object that will navigate to [login to view URL] whenever a button is clicked. It should also include a document completed event fired. Please specify that you read all the requirements and specify how you suggest to implement authentication.
Project ID: 16592272

About the project

19 proposals
Remote project
Active 6 yrs ago

Looking to make some money?

Benefits of bidding on Freelancer

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s
Awarded to:
User Avatar
Hi I'm c# developer with 12 years experience on .net framework and related tools. I'll create this app with c#.net. for authentication I'll get username and password from user and return a hashed token to client with expire time. Also I save those data on database and check it when client pass the token to server on each request. please send a message for me to have discussion about details.
$200 USD in 3 days
4.9 (32 reviews)
5.8
5.8
19 freelancers are bidding on average $235 USD for this job
User Avatar
Hi, I checked all the points. I am not clear about the requirement of Point 6. Can you explain what exactly you mean by that. For authentication we can use token based (New method) on we can use key. It mean we will manage API key, user have to send key for all the request. If key found then authenticated or not authorized user (Old method). I have not worked any project in core so i given my timeline 3 days. In this i can look at the core structure and get the work done. But still i will try to deliver before then given timeline. Thanks.
$277 USD in 3 days
4.9 (57 reviews)
6.5
6.5
User Avatar
Hi, How are you ? I have strong skills for asp.net core 2.0 mvc. I have experience for web api (Restful web service). I read the job description carefully. I can build basic project perfectly. Thanks Lee
$333 USD in 3 days
5.0 (8 reviews)
5.4
5.4
User Avatar
I worked and successfully delivered web projects for various enterprise. Relevant Skills and Experience : I have 8 + years experience in .NET with JAVA, Swing, Spring, Struts 2.0 , C#,VB,ASP.NET, Web Service, WCF, Node.js, React.js, Javascript, JQuery, SQL, XML ,XSLT and HTML. I will implement Cookie-based authentication with Identity to implement authentication in application. I Can implment JWT Bearer Authentication also if it is required in project.
$388 USD in 3 days
5.0 (38 reviews)
5.1
5.1
User Avatar
Hello, I am ready to finish project Today if you award me in next hour I will use local authentication using JWT Token for Client i will use Windows forms application
$133 USD in 1 day
5.0 (25 reviews)
5.0
5.0
User Avatar
Hello I hace created the webapi in asp.net core 2.1 and having very good experience with get an post requests. I have also used the jwt authentication, facebook, google, office 365 with azure active directory. please give me chace to work on it. if I am using facook authentication the after login into facebook, facebook return reuest code and using that code we will get details of login user and save into our db after saving the data into db we will genrate the jw token for particular time of interval loke 1 hour or 2 hour as per requirements. Thanks
$333 USD in 4 days
5.0 (11 reviews)
4.0
4.0
User Avatar
Hi, I am an expert .Net developer with 3 years of experience I would like to have an opportunity to work with you. If you wish we can have a quick chat to discuss in detail for the same Waiting forward for a positive response Thanks Bansi
$200 USD in 10 days
4.4 (7 reviews)
3.3
3.3
User Avatar
Hi, This is Juber Qureshi from Mumbai (INDIA). I have more than 10 years of experience in .Net technologies and now I want to leave the salary job and want to start my own IT company and here for the same. I saw your review rating and that's the reason why I sharing all this with you, your way of project requirement is very clear, so it's made easy to work on the project(s) given by you. As you asked in the description, what authentication to use, so here I will go the google first and if require can create custom. My bid is not just for this project, it's for starting a long-term business with you. Thanks & Regards, Juber Qureshi
$155 USD in 3 days
5.0 (1 review)
2.7
2.7
User Avatar
Hello, I've read the requirements and have the following notes: with regards to server side, I have used asp.net core 2 to create JWT's for authentication using both local and social authentication (Oauth). For this purposes of this project I would suggest using local. I would use entity framework for managing the connection to the SQL database. with regards to the client side, it's not completely clear in your spec what tech stack you would like it built on. Would this require a asp.net MVC website style client, a javascript type client or were you thinking about a desktop client (eg WPF/UWP) please feel free to open a chat to discuss.
$250 USD in 5 days
5.0 (6 reviews)
2.8
2.8
User Avatar
We Have experience of developing .Net core application with Visual studio 17 , core2.0 and,identity framework With single sign On ,entity frameworkfew more which we can discuss if you have interest Relevant Skills and Experience We have experience in such project of more then 1 yr on core 2 we can discuss thnigs if you are interested in and can send you some snaps our project if required
$166 USD in 3 days
5.0 (1 review)
0.0
0.0
User Avatar
ERP developer
$244 USD in 5 days
0.0 (0 reviews)
0.0
0.0
User Avatar
A proposal has not yet been provided
$255 USD in 5 days
0.0 (0 reviews)
0.0
0.0
User Avatar
The scope of the project is a simple .Net core 2 / MVC 6 web api and a simple test client. Clients should be created using Visual Studio 2017, Windows Platform, ASP.NET Core 2 MVC, c#, SQL Server (Not SQL Express). We will provide simple SQL server table
$144 USD in 3 days
0.0 (0 reviews)
0.0
0.0

About the client

Flag of UNITED STATES
Miami, United States
4.9
90
Payment method verified
Member since Mar 3, 2009

Client Verification

Thanks! We’ve emailed you a link to claim your free credit.
Something went wrong while sending your email. Please try again.
Registered Users Total Jobs Posted
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Loading preview
Permission granted for Geolocation.
Your login session has expired and you have been logged out. Please log in again.